在学习了C++后,感觉到其面向对象的思想与 C 的面向程序的不同之处。在对象内部定义对其的操作,只提供接口供用户使用,其操作对用户隐藏。所以我也仿写了一个简单的类及几个运算符的重载。
但是还存在一个问题,我一直也没解决,就是我的几个重载运算符想要写成内联函数,但是由于参数问题,我只会写成友元了。望大神可以指点一二。
上代码吧
#include<stdio.h>
#include<iostream>
#include<string>
#include<cassert>
using namespace std;
class Student {
public:
//几种构造函数
Student() = default;
Student(const string &s) : nameNo(s) { }
Student(const string &s, int chi, int ma) :
nameNo(s), chinese(chi), math(ma), sumgrade (chi + ma) { }
Student(const Student&); //拷贝构造函数
string name() const {return nameNo;}
int grade() const {return sumgrade;} //返回总分
double avg_grade() const; //求平均值
//几种重载运算符
Student& operator +=(const Student&);
friend istream& operator >>(istream &is, Student &item);
friend ostream& operator <<(ostream &os, Student &item);
friend bool operator ==(const Student &lhs, const Student &rhs);
friend bool operator !=(const Student &lhs, const Student &rhs);
friend Student operator +(const Student &lhs, const Student &rhs);
friend bool operator <(const Student &lhs, const Student &rhs);
friend bool operator >(const Student &lhs, const Student &rhs);
~Student() = default; //析构函数
private:
string nameNo; //姓名
int chinese = 0; //语文分数
int math = 0; //数学分数
int sumgrade = 0; //总分
};
Student::Student(const Student &item) :
nameNo(item.nameNo),
chinese(item.chinese),
math(item.math),
sumgrade(item.sumgrade)
{ }
double Student::avg_grade() const {
if (sumgrade)
return sumgrade / 2.0;
else
return 0;
}
Student& Student::operator +=(const Student &item) {
chinese += item.chinese;
math += item.math;
sumgrade += item.sumgrade;
return *this;
}
istream& operator >>(istream &is, Student &item) {
is >> item.nameNo >> item.chinese >> item.math;
if (is)
item.sumgrade = item.chinese + item.math;
else
item = Student();
return is;
}
ostream& operator <<(ostream &os, Student &item) {
os << item.name() << " " << item.chinese << " "
<< item.math << " " << item.sumgrade;
return os;
}
bool operator ==(const Student &lhs, const Student &rhs) {
return lhs.name() == rhs.name();
}
bool operator !=(const Student &lhs, const Student &rhs) {
return !(lhs == rhs);
}
Student operator +(const Student &lhs, const Student &rhs) {
Student sum = lhs;
sum += rhs;
return sum;
}
bool operator <(const Student &lhs, const Student &rhs) {
return lhs.sumgrade < rhs.sumgrade;
}
bool operator >(const Student &lhs, const Student &rhs) {
return lhs.sumgrade > rhs.sumgrade;
}
